quote:

You may have one in attic near AC unit or water heater

This.........OR and this is going to sound retarded BUT all smoke detectors "expire". I don't know how old your house or detectors are but the detectors will expire after approx. 10 yrs.

The solution: you have to replace all of them......I know from experience.
